|
|
|
|
|
by swiftcoder
1 day ago
|
|
> if we started from scratch today, we wouldn't choose to have it this way, but we started a different way before, and it's been a difficult path to get to where we want to be" This is just how software development for a large public project goes. If you want to land big changes in a finite amount of time, you take the path that breaks the least number of things along the way. Once the whole ecosystem is rust-based, they can always trim out some of the redundant intermediate representations for performance gains. |
|